Sand Casting: The sand casting process also called as sand mold casting. It is a common method for metal casting. Almost 70% of metal casting of product follow by sand casting process. The bonding agent (clay) is mixed with the sand. The mixture is moisturized with water for develop strength and plasticity of clay to make mold.

Nov 11, 2017· 13. Sand Holes. It is the holes created on the external surface or inside the casting. It occurs when loose sand washes into the mold cavity and fuses into the interior of the casting or rapid pouring of the molten metal. Causes: (i) Loose ramming of the sand.

The ability to cast a wide variety of metals: Sand mold casting allows for the use of almost any metal or metal alloy. For example, manufacturers can utilize this process to create castings in cast iron, copper, copper alloys, carbon steel, steel alloys, gold, stainless steel, brass, silver and complex metal alloys.
The sand mold creating process involves use of a metal, furnace, sand mold and pattern. The aluminum is melted in the furnace and then poured into the cavity of the sand mold formed by a pattern. The mold separates along a parting line to remove the aluminum casting. A sand mold is created by packing sand into two halves of the mold.

Creating a sand mold for concrete is a quick and inexpensive method of reproducing ornamental objects in concrete form. The process uses fine wet sand to hold the image of the casting model. The sand is just strong enough to avoid crumbling as you pour concrete into the depression left by the mold.
In casting aluminum objects, molten aluminum is poured into a mold. One of the techniques for making an aluminum mold is called sand casting. It involves mixing fine sand, some clay, and a small amount of water to make the mixture cohesive. This mixture is called green sand because it is moist, not because it is actually green.
The process cycle for sand casting consists of six main stages, which are explained below. Mold-making - The first step in the sand casting process is to create the mold for the casting. In an expendable mold process, this step must be performed for each casting.
Mold Setup For Sand Casting: The setup of a sand mold in manufacturing involves using a pattern to create an impression of the part to be sand cast within the mold, removal of the pattern, the placement of cores, (if needed), and the creation of a gating system within the mold. Cores are useful for features that cannot tolerate draft or to provide detail that cannot otherwise be integrated into a core-less casting or mold.. The main disadvantage is the additional cost to incorporate cores.

Sand casting is a process that utilizes non-reusable sand molds to form metal castings.It is a common production method for metal components of all sizes, from a few ounces to several tons. Sand casting isn't only versatile in the size of its products – it can also create exceptionally complex or detailed castings, and can be used to cast nearly any metal alloy.
A collection of wooden patterns typically found in sand casting foundries. Casting is the process of pouring liquid metal into a mold, where it cools and solidifies. The casting process can produce everything from art pieces to engine parts.
Sep 19, 2017· The sand mold is in an uncured state as the metal is being poured. Sand casting using green sand is quick and inexpensive since the sand can be reused. The downside is that the sand is a soft mold and can collapse or shift during casting, leaving an unusable cast. However, the process is reliable enough that it has survived for centuries and is ...
